Prince Abdulaziz bin Saud bin Naif, Interior Minister and Supreme Hajj Committee Chairman, visited the General Transport Center in Arafat to oversee Hajj transport operations. Accompanied by Transport Minister Saleh Al-Jasser and Royal Commission CEO Eng. Saleh Al-Rasheed, he reviewed real-time crowd management systems and shuttle route planning. The center ensures smooth pilgrim movement between Mina and the Grand Mosque using live data analysis.
